OUR STRATEGY :

Our strategy is a reflection of God’s divine direction. As the scripture says in Prov. 3:6, “In all your ways acknowledge Him, and He will direct thy path”. What we are doing is to continuously trust the Lord to grant us the grace daily to pray and seek his face for direction(s) as we accurately fulfill the vision He has entrusted to us. These directions formulate the following strategies:

  1. Evangelizing the lost and reaching the unreached: Through door-to-door evangelism: Evangelism team members and the entire congregation are encouraged on a regular basis to reach out to lost souls. Weekly outreach activities are scheduled for this purpose.
  2. Crusades in unreached Towns and Villages: Crusades are held periodically in unreached towns and villages, and missionaries are sent to these areas to plant churches.
  3. Training the Believers: Believers are trained and prepared for the work of the ministry through weekly discipleship classes which include membership classes, cell group ministry, seminars, etc. The believer(s) and convert(s) in each community are organized in “cell groups” called the Covenant Family Meeting. The goal is to bring the believer in the community together for prayer, Bible study, fellowship and outreach.
  4. Training is also done for the unlearned or illiterate through the adult literacy program that helps people read their Bible for personal growth in God’s word.
  5. Outdoor Film Shows: Outdoor film shows are shown in unreached towns, villages and surrounding communities presenting the simplicity and power of the gospel of Jesus Christ; His death, burial and resurrection.
  6. Tracts: Tracts are distributed during outreaches in market places, the communities, etc. This creates the opportunity to have a one-on-one contact with people, and have them invited to weekly fellowship.
  7. Training Missionaries: A very important aspect of our strategy is the training of missionaries. As we pray and God prepares the hearts of people for the mission field, they are trained in practical missions basics and specifics of the vision of the church (ministry).

We also sent trained missionaries to areas where churches are planted. These sent-missionaries are also encouraged to train labourers to get actively involve with the work.
